The loans which are covered under the popular government MSME schemes are generally terms loans and working capital loans with an upper limit cap of Rs. 100 lakh per borrowing unit. Such loans are collateral-free loans that are given to new or existing micro and small business entities.

So, how can MSME entities apply for the collateral-free MSME loan?

Steps for applying for collateral-free MSME loan 

  • Avail the MSME / Udyog Aadhar Registration Certificate.
  • The collateral-free loans under the MSME Loan Scheme can then be obtained by MSME registered business entities through the partner banks.
  • Banks would ask for the requisite documents which would need to be submitted to the bank’s representative for proceeding on the loan application process.
  • Eligibility criteria would be decided by the bank on the basis of the criteria set by the Ministry for MSME.
  • Once eligibility approved by the bank, the loan amount gets directly disbursed into the entity’s bank account.

Points to Remember: 

MSME / Udyog Aadhar Registration Certificate is a must before applying for a collateral-free MSME loan.

Term loan or working capital loan is allowed with a maximum limit of Rs. 100 lakh per borrowing unit.
